Timezone in Sandon
Sandon is located in the Europe/Rome timezone, which operates on Central European Time (CET) with a UTC offset of +1. During daylight saving time, known as Central European Summer Time (CEST), the offset changes to UTC +2. Daylight saving time in Sandon starts on the last Sunday in March and ends on the last Sunday in October, meaning clocks are set forward one hour in spring and set back one hour in autumn.
